Thomas
L. Magnanti
Dean, MIT School of Engineering
|
Thomas
L. Magnanti is the Dean of the School of Engineering and
one of fourteen Institute Professors at MIT where he has
been a faculty member since 1971. He has devoted much of
his professional career to education that combines engineering
and management and to teaching and research in applied and
theoretical aspects of large-scale optimization.
Professor
Magnanti was a founding co-director of MIT's industry-university
collaborative research and educational program, Leaders
for Manufacturing Program, and its on-campus off-campus
graduate program, System
Design and Management. He has previously served as head
of the Management Science Area (about one-third) of the
Sloan
School of Management and as co-director of MIT's interdepartmental
Operations
Research Center. He is a past President of the Operations
Research Society of America (ORSA) and of the Institute
of Operations Research and Management Sciences (INFORMS)
and has been Editor-in-Chief of the journal Operations
Research.
Dr.
Magnanti currently serves on the International Advisory
Board of Linköping University in Sweden, President's
Council of Olin College, and the advisory boards of the
Harvard Business School and the Stanford School of Engineering.
He has previously served as a member of the National Research
Council's Manufacturing Studies Board and on the board of
the Lemelson-MIT
Prize Committee.
Professor
Magnanti received an undergraduate degree in Chemical Engineering
from Syracuse University (1967) and master's degrees in
both Statistics (1969) and Mathematics (1971) from Stanford
University, where he also received his doctorate in Operations
Research (1972).
On two
occasions, Professor Magnanti has been a research fellow
at the Center for Operations Research and Econometrics at
the University of Louvain in Belgium. He has been a visiting
scholar at the Harvard Business School and has held visiting
scientist appointments at Bell Laboratories and at GTE Laboratories.
He has also previously served as a member of the corporate
manufacturing staff of Digital Equipment Corporation, on
the Science and Technology Council of Inland Steel, and
as a consultant to Sabre Technology Solutions. He currently
serves on the Boards of the Ford Design Institute and Emptoris,
Inc.
Professor
Magnanti's research and teaching interests focus on the
theory and application of large-scale optimization, particularly
in the areas of network flows, nonlinear programming, and
combinatorial optimization. He has conducted research on
such topics as production planning and scheduling, transportation
planning, facility location, logistics, and communication
systems design. Dr. Magnanti has served on thesis committees
for approximately 70 doctoral students, supervising over
25. His publications include co-authorship of two textbooks,
Applied Mathematical Programming and Network Flows:
Theory, Algorithms and Applications, and the co-editorship
of two other books.
In addition
to his editorship of Operations Research, Professor
Magnanti has served on the editorial board and as an advisory
editor of several journals and book series in the fields
of management science, transportation, applied mathematics,
and computer science.
He has
received the MIT Billard Award and the ORSA Kimball Medal
for distinguished service, as well as the Irwin Sizer Award
for significant innovations in MIT education. He has also
received the 1993 Lanchester Prize for best publication
in the field of operations research and has received honorary
doctorates from Linköping University, the University
of Montreal, and the Université Catholique de Louvain.
Professor Magnanti is a member of the National Academy of
Engineering and the American Academy of Arts and Sciences.
